I came across a Winchester 22 pump action, gallery gun that has been in our family for over 50 years. I tried looking up the serial number; 642435 but have not as yet found any information as to when it was manufactured. I’m not interested in selling it as it does have sentimental value. Does anyone have any further information?

It appears that you have a Model 90 or a Model 06 that has been rebarreled with a newer Model 62 barrel. Is there a letter “A” or “B” stamped below the serial number? If possible, please provide clear pictures of the rifle to include all of the stamped factory markings on the barrel and receiver frame.
